Man Allegedly Kills Three Daughters in Jharkhand

A man in Giridih, Jharkhand, reportedly used a sharp weapon to kill his three minor daughters on Monday morning. The accused was promptly apprehended following the incident. The tragic event occurred in Turukdih village under the jurisdiction of the Mufassil police station in Giridih, causing shock and fear in the community.

The victims have been identified as Pallavi Yadav, aged 14, and her six-year-old twin sisters, Riddhi Yadav and Siddhi Yadav. According to the police, the father, Nandu Yadav, suddenly became violent in the morning and fatally attacked his daughters inside their home with a sharp weapon, resulting in their immediate deaths. Upon hearing the children’s cries, family members rushed to the scene, but the assailant continued his assault.

Local witnesses mentioned that the man’s wife and son managed to escape unharmed by moving to another part of the house during the tragic incident. The brutal killings plunged the entire village into grief, attracting a large crowd of residents as the news spread rapidly. Law enforcement officials, including Mufassil police station in-charge Shyam Kishore Mahto and Sadar SDPO Jitwahan Oraon, arrived at the village with a police team upon receiving the information. The accused was swiftly taken into custody to prevent any retaliation from the enraged locals.
